Mala's Fruit Products Pvt. Ltd. is a renowned Indian company specializing in processed fruit products ranging from fruit syrups, jams, and mocktails. Founded in 1958 by Taiyab Mala, the company started from humble beginnings in Panchgani, Maharashtra, and has since grown to become a key player in India’s food processing industry. Mala's has not raised any significant external funding, operating instead as a privately held entity focused on quality production. Its products are distributed widely across India and internationally.

Mala's Fruit Products began in the 1950s when Taiyab Mala saw an opportunity in processed fruits, a concept relatively new to India at the time. Starting with homemade jams, Mala leveraged traditional techniques learned from various local institutes. Initially producing a small quantity, the company steadily expanded its operations as the popularity of its products grew. By the 1970s, Mala’s jams and syrups were well-established in the local market, paving the way for national distribution by the early 1980s.
